Union boys edge Sewickley Academy
Union (49) Vs. Sewickley (47)
The Union High boys basketball team made the plays down the stretch to earn a win Saturday.

The Scotties deflected the ball away on an inbounds pass and time expired in a 49-47 nonsection home win over Sewickley Academy.

Union (4-8) led 49-47 with 3.1 seconds to play. The Panthers (5-3) were inbounding the ball under their own basket. They threw the ball in and the Scotties were able to get a piece of it. By the time the ball landed out of bounds the clock expired.

Union was coming off a 69-46 WPIAL Section 1-A home loss to Western Beaver the night before. It was the section opener for both schools.

“The kids came to play,” Scotties coach Dave Smialowski said. “Our intenesity wasn’t there on Friday.

“That’s somethng we talked about. They came out and competed (on Saturday). That’s a solid Sewickley Academy team. We’ll take a win and hopefully we can build from it.”

Anthony Rush and Benjamin Young both scored 14 points to lead Union. Young added seven assists and five rebounds, while Rush was 5 of 7 from the field, including 4 of 5 from behind the arc.

The Scotties were 11 of 20 from three-point range.

“They were double-teaming Ben and he was finding the open man,” Smialowski said. “To their credit, they knocked them down. We need them to step up and hit them.

“If the other guys can step up and hit the shots, it will open things up more for Young.”

Jamie Hooks pulled down a game-high 10 rebounds for Union.

Drew Johnson paced the Panthers with 14 points.
